**Vendor note: Inkmill markdown pipeline**

Rendering for Parchway docs is outsourced to Inkmill under an annual contract, renewing each March. They handle sanitization and PDF export; we own the upload queue. SLA: 4-hour response on rendering failures. Escalate only after two failed retries. Their support desk is reachable at the address below.

billing contact of hahaf-baguf = zorael.tammir.jorius@sivrelhq.internal

Plugin authors: any themed widget rendered inside the Lumenhatch
// shell must meet or exceed this ratio against its computed background,
// including hover and disabled states, which the audit flagged as the
// most common failure points. Do not override this value locally; the
// validator in the submission pipeline checks against the canonical
// copy. The audit build that established this threshold is recorded
// under the token below.

session token of tajef-bageg = htk21_5d90d574934f3ccae6437

## Deploying the Gatewick Proctor Queue

Deploys are pretty painless: push to main, wait for the pipeline, then watch the queue drain dashboard for five minutes. If candidates pile up mid-exam, roll back first and ask questions later — the queue replays safely. Everything the workers care about lives in one config block, shown here for reference.

settings of bafof-yagef:
JOROX_PIN=8740
JOROX_TENANT=pelox
JOROX_METRICS_HOST=metrics.jorox.qorvelworks.internal
JOROX_SEAL=seal_c78f63c1
JOROX_STANDBY_TEAM=norax

Handover: localization extraction script

For the security review: the strings-extract script (lexiscan.py) walks the Bramleaf app repos, pulls translatable strings, and pushes them to the internal catalog. It runs under a scoped service account with read-only repo access; no user data is touched. Kera owns it after this week. The script runs with the following configuration values.

settings of fafog-haduf:
ZORIX_PIN=4648
ZORIX_METRICS_HOST=metrics.zorix.paliqsys.corp
ZORIX_LOG_LEVEL=info
ZORIX_TENANT=druix